Sat 883175902910124

decimal
176635.902910124
degree
0°176635′1243″902910124‴
percentile
42.05599542293418%
name
hpbxorlaslx
cycle
0
epoch
0
period
87
block
176635
offset
902910124
timestamp
rarity
common
inscriptions
location
3a381737b63f9577c86b65b02c5c75abd15f2c3efeeab599eece3722a90e5a0c:4:214913119
address
1HwtivZV9Bvqe5eV3HSffruF25NQTEuQyY